S01 EP03 >>>>
From last 3 years I have been watching this show in every winter to enjoy my winter like the way I enjoyed my winter vacation when i watched the show for the first time....and i feel like episode 3 is best ...However it doesn't feel the same like the first time so probably I am watching it for the last time...perhaps until the next season released